Output 90d84ddb5dae14f4ee8bfe3e66d3434b868f2d5c919e93ef17cd114d79723b85:22

value
1239069087
script pubkey
OP_0 OP_PUSHBYTES_20 67a49fd9603ccb84136371af5334b62395e6c826
address
bc1qv7jflktq8n9cgymrwxh4xd9kyw27djpx46902w
transaction
90d84ddb5dae14f4ee8bfe3e66d3434b868f2d5c919e93ef17cd114d79723b85
confirmations
207833
spent
true